Pagina 1 di 1

[RISOLTO] Errore di aggiornamento del pacchetto WebView

Pubblicato: 19 novembre 2024 - 08:11
di PaulSLA
Buongiorno,

Quando aggiorniamo WebView tramite WAPT (che finora non ha mai rappresentato un problema), WAPT restituisce:

Codice: Seleziona tutto

"Installing: MicrosoftEdgeWebView2RuntimeInstallerX64.exe (131.0.2903.51)
Waiting for key: Microsoft EdgeWebView to appear in Windows registry
Traceback (most recent call last):
  File "C:\Program Files (x86)\wapt\common.py", line 4235, in install_wapt
    exitstatus = setup.install()
  File "C:\WINDOWS\TEMP\wapt92bprthg\setup.py", line 9, in install
  File "C:\Program Files (x86)\wapt\common.py", line 4165, in new_func
    return func(*args, **kwargs)
  File "C:\Program Files (x86)\wapt\setuphelpers_windows.py", line 1703, in install_exe_if_needed
    error('Setup %s has been installed but the %s can not be found' % (exe,searchparam))
  File "C:\Program Files (x86)\wapt\waptutils.py", line 1957, in error
    raise EWaptSetupException('Fatal error : %s' % reason)
waptutils.EWaptSetupException: Fatal error : Setup MicrosoftEdgeWebView2RuntimeInstallerX64.exe has been installed but the key Microsoft EdgeWebView can not be found

EWaptSetupException: Fatal error : Setup MicrosoftEdgeWebView2RuntimeInstallerX64.exe has been installed but the key Microsoft EdgeWebView can not be found
"
Dopo aver controllato le workstation, il Runtime non compare nell'elenco dei programmi da disinstallare e la reinstallazione manuale fallisce perché il software risulta già installato secondo il programma di installazione.
Questo errore si verifica in seguito a un altro errore riscontrato nella versione 130 di WebView:

Codice: Seleziona tutto

"Installing: MicrosoftEdgeWebView2RuntimeInstallerX64.exe (130.0.2849.80)
Traceback (most recent call last):
  File "C:\Program Files (x86)\wapt\common.py", line 4235, in install_wapt
    exitstatus = setup.install()
  File "C:\WINDOWS\TEMP\wapt3dkkje_j\setup.py", line 9, in install
  File "C:\Program Files (x86)\wapt\common.py", line 4165, in new_func
    return func(*args, **kwargs)
  File "C:\Program Files (x86)\wapt\setuphelpers_windows.py", line 1689, in install_exe_if_needed
    run(r'"%s" %s' % (exe, silentflags), accept_returncodes=accept_returncodes, timeout=timeout, pidlist=pidlist)
  File "C:\Program Files (x86)\wapt\waptutils.py", line 2177, in run
    raise CalledProcessErrorOutput(proc.returncode, cmd, ''.join(output))
waptutils.CalledProcessErrorOutput: Command '"MicrosoftEdgeWebView2RuntimeInstallerX64.exe" /silent /install' returned non-zero exit status 2147748109.
Output:
"
Si presentavano gli stessi sintomi: era impossibile reinstallarlo manualmente e non era presente nell'elenco dei programmi.

Questo problema riguarda attualmente tutti i PC che hanno ricevuto l'aggiornamento. Qualcun altro ha riscontrato questo problema? In tal caso, come lo avete risolto?

Grazie in anticipo !

Re: Errore di aggiornamento del pacchetto WebView

Pubblicato: 19 novembre 2024 - 13:59
di jlepiquet
Ciao,

Microsoft ha questa fastidiosa tendenza a cambiare le cose che funzionano senza preavviso.

Dalla versione 131, WebView non viene più registrato come applicazione separata, ma solo come componente aggiuntivo di Edge.

Stiamo cercando di capire come risolvere questo problema.

Re: Errore di aggiornamento del pacchetto WebView

Pubblicato: 21 novembre 2024 - 08:54
di PaulSLA
Salve,

grazie per la risposta.

Se ho capito bene, non c'è nulla che possiamo fare a livello locale?

Cordiali saluti,

Re: Errore di aggiornamento del pacchetto WebView

Pubblicato: 21 novembre 2024 - 11:56
di jlepiquet
Salve,

il pacchetto è stato aggiornato nello store per risolvere il problema.

Cordiali saluti,

Re: Errore di aggiornamento del pacchetto WebView

Pubblicato: 25 novembre 2024 - 09:19
di jcdemarque
Grazie, avevo esattamente lo stesso problema. Possiamo contrassegnare la discussione come risolta?

Buona giornata.

Re: [RISOLTO] Errore di aggiornamento del pacchetto WebView

Pubblicato: 25 novembre 2024 - 10:16
di dcardon
Ciao Jean-Charles,

grazie per il feedback. :-)

Ho contrassegnato la discussione come risolta!

Denis